Why Storm Damage Repair Matters in Winter Park

Winter Park's climate, characterized by an average annual rainfall of 63 inches, significantly impacts roof longevity and storm damage susceptibility. Frequent heavy rains can exploit even minor roof vulnerabilities, leading to leaks and rot if not addressed. While direct hail days are uncommon, the region's 110 mph design wind speed means roofing systems must withstand substantial uplift forces. These sustained winds can loosen shingles, compromise flashing, and exacerbate existing wear, making robust repair techniques crucial for long-term protection against the specific atmospheric challenges faced by Orange County homes.

Building Code & Wind Zone

Design Wind Speed: 110 mph

Standard wind zone — Orange County, Florida

Per the Florida Building Code (FBC 7th Edition), all roofing materials installed here must be rated for 110 mph wind speeds. This affects material selection, fastener patterns, and installation methods.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the typical permit requirements for storm damage roof repair in Winter Park?

In Winter Park, storm damage roof repairs typically require a building permit from Orange County. This ensures the work complies with local building codes, including specific fastener requirements for our 110 mph wind zone. What is the usual timeline for storm damage roof repair projects in Winter Park, considering local weather patterns?

The typical timeline for storm damage roof repair in Winter Park can range from a few days for minor repairs to two weeks for a full roof replacement, depending on the extent of the damage. Our scheduling takes into account Orange County's frequent afternoon thunderstorms, especially during the summer months, to minimize disruptions. Are there specific insurance carrier preferences or requirements for storm damage claims in Orange County, FL?

While there aren't specific insurance carrier preferences unique to Winter Park, navigating storm damage claims in Orange County requires thorough documentation. Insurance companies typically require detailed assessments, photographic evidence, and itemized repair estimates.
